Lanzignac
Lanzignac is a hamlet in Landeleau, Arrondissement of Châteaulin, Brittany. Lanzignac is situated nearby to the hamlet Le Vern-Guern Franquet, as well as near Loch ar Vur - Kêr Henri.| Tap on a place to explore it |
